Scrapy 异步问题求助

查看 40|回复 1
作者:kekeones   
使用 Scrapy 爬取内容,使用 Pipeline 将处理后内容 POST 到远程。
使用request是同步的会有阻塞。
使用scrapy.FormRequest受限于全局DOWNLOAD_DELAY限制,每次 POST 都会有延迟。
使用 treq ,不确定如何获取内容
async def process_post(self, url, data):
    req = treq.post(url, data=data)
    res = await deferred_to_future(req)
    return res
如何获取 res 的内容,打印是[tr]

Scrapy, res, post, Data

encro   
不看源码?
看 treq.response._Response 的源码啊!!!
您需要登录后才可以回帖 登录 | 立即注册

返回顶部